In recognition for his years of dedicated service in promoting the goals of the Fly Fishers of Davis, the FFD Board has unanimously renamed our annual Fish Camp scholarship to the Cary Boyden Youth Fish Camp Scholarship.

Over the years, Cary has exemplified the most important values of our club, which are highlighted by his skill, his knowledge as a fly angler, his camaraderie and especially his friendship. We hope that all who are awarded the Cary Boyden Youth Fish Camp Scholarship follow in his footsteps, and embody the great values that he has provided to our club.

Fly Fishers of Davis offers the Cary Boyden Youth Fish Camp Scholarship to any interested boy or girl, from 10 to 15 years of age.  This scholarship covers the entire cost of the five day program, which is conducted by The Fly Shop of Redding.

FishCamp™ is a 5-day, 4 night summer fly fishing adventure in Northern California. The program teaches fly fishing and other outdoor skills in a safe and friendly environment, and is held on a private ranch at the base of Mt. Shasta.  The program includes accommodations, meals, and use of the finest in fly fishing equipment.

Fish Camp is serious fun, with plenty of time every day for fishing, workshops, and stories around the campfire. Some of the lessons include:

  • Fly Casting and Fly Tying
  • Knots
  • Basic Entomology
  • Reading the Water
  • Safe Wading
  • Catch & Release
  • Leave-No-Trace
